WHAT IS The CORE Science Solutions (CSS) GI Cancer Consortium?
The GI Cancer Consortium is an innovative and focused full service research model created to enhance the state of care for GI cancer patients, with a goal of expediting the process of identifying and efficiently testing active new compounds for the treatment of GI cancers. Our ability to rapidly design and execute focused clinical trials in GI cancers will enhance our partner sponsors ability to make informed decisions on the development of their compounds. Ultimately, the GI Cancer Consortium's goal is to serve as an important model for speeding time-to-market for drugs targeting all GI cancers.
This innovative model is the merger of full service operations with a select group of the best and brightest investigators from prestigious cancer centers around the country. Each member demonstrates clinical and translational research capabilities in GI cancers and shares a common commitment to exploring and creating new frontiers in GI cancer research.
The GI Cancer Consortium builds upon the complementary strengths of the member institutions selected for the Consortium, each of which is funded via a competitive support grant to be used for expanding and supplementing their ongoing clinical and translational gastrointestinal cancer programs.
